What is an Off Grid Solar System?

An off grid solar system refers to a solar energy setup that operates independently of the national grid. Unlike grid-tied systems that send excess energy back to the grid, off grid systems are designed to store energy in batteries for later use. This type of system is perfect for remote locations where the grid is not available or for those who want to achieve energy independence.

How Off Grid Solar Systems Work?

The basic components of an off-grid solar system include:

  • Solar Panels: These capture sunlight and convert it into electricity.
  • Off Grid Inverter: Converts direct current (DC) generated by the solar panels into alternating current (AC) used by most household appliances.
  • Batteries: Store the electricity for use when sunlight is not available.
  • Charge Controller: Regulates the power going into the batteries to prevent overcharging.

How to Calculate Off Grid Solar System Requirements?

Before investing in an off grid solar system, it’s essential to calculate your energy needs to ensure the system will meet your requirements.

  1. Calculate Daily Energy Use: Add up the total wattage of all appliances you intend to use and multiply by the number of hours each appliance will be used. Example: If you have a fridge (200 watts) running for 10 hours, the total energy consumption will be:

200 watts × 10 hours = 2000 watts/hours (2KWh)

  1. Determine Solar Panel Capacity: Based on your total daily energy consumption, decide how many solar panels you need. If your daily usage is 10 kWh, and each panel generates 1 kWh per day, you’ll need 10 panels.
  2. Battery Capacity: Calculate battery storage by considering how many days of backup you need. Multiply your daily energy use by the number of days you want to store power for.
  3. Inverter Size: Your inverter should match or slightly exceed your total load. For example, if your daily peak load is 3KW, you need at least a 3KW inverter.

The total cost of an off grid solar system varies depending on the size, brand, and installation charges. Below are approximate price ranges for popular system sizes:

SpecificationsAvg. Min Price (PKR)Avg. Max Price (PKR)
3 Kilo Watt350,000450,000
5 Kilo Watt500,000650,000
10 Kilo Watt1,000,0001,400,000
100 Kilo Watt10,000,00012,000,000
Off Grid Solar System Prices in Pakistan

Note: These prices include solar panels, batteries, inverters, and installation.

Off-Grid Solar Battery System

Batteries play a crucial role in off-grid solar systems, storing energy for later use. The most common types of batteries used include:

  • Lead-Acid Batteries: Cheaper but require maintenance.
  • Lithium-Ion Batteries: More expensive but have a longer lifespan and better efficiency.
